Dhirendra Nanji Lakhani (“Dhiru”) was born in in Porbandar, India. His early years were spent in Calicut, where his father was a forester. Independent and strong willed as a youngster, Dhiru went against his family’s expectations of him joining the family business and decided to apply to medical school. He gained admission to Kasturba Medical College and qualified from Manipal University in 1974. During his undergraduate training, he met his future wife, Chetna, and they began planning their life together.
